Understanding AI-Documented Schema and Data Standards

Before diving into optimization techniques, it's crucial to grasp what AI-documenting schemas and data standards entail. Schemas act as structured frameworks that classify and define the type of content on your website, such as articles, products, reviews, and events. Standardized schemas, primarily from Schema.org, provide AI systems with clear, machine-readable metadata.

Adhering to data standards means ensuring your structured data conforms to specific formats like JSON-LD, Microdata, or RDFa, which are universally recognized by search engines and AI platforms. Proper implementation helps AI interpret your content accurately, leading to enhanced snippets, rich results, and better visibility.

Best Practices for Optimizing Content with Schema and Data Standards

To maximize your website's promotion potential, consider the following best practices:

  1. Use JSON-LD format: It's recommended by search engines for its ease of implementation and clarity.
  2. Be specific with schemas: Choose the most accurate schema type, whether Article, Product, or Event, to represent your content.
  3. Ensure data accuracy: Keep all metadata up-to-date and free of errors to prevent misinterpretation.
  4. Validate your structured data: Use tools like Google's Rich Results Test to check for issues.
  5. Implement comprehensive schemas: Cover multiple aspects such as reviews, ratings, authors, and other relevant details for richer promotion.

Practical Example: Schema Markup for a Local Business

Consider a local restaurant looking to boost its visibility. Implementing the LocalBusiness schema with details like name, address, opening hours, and reviews can impact how the restaurant appears in local AI-driven searches. Here is a simplified JSON-LD example:

{ "@context": "https://schema.org", "@type": "LocalBusiness", "name": "Gourmet Bistro", "address": { "@type": "PostalAddress", "streetAddress": "123 Main St", "addressLocality": "Sample City", "postalCode": "12345", "addressCountry": "US" }, "telephone": "+1-555-123-4567", "openingHours": ["Mo-Sa 11:00-22:00"], "review": { "@type": "Review", "author": "Jane Doe", "reviewRating": { "@type": "Rating", "ratingValue": "5" }, "description": "Excellent food and friendly service!" }}
